Is Timorasso Derthona a red or white grape variety?
Timorasso Derthona is a white wine grape variety. Sensium documents its structure, aromas, and confusion signals for blind tasting.
What does Timorasso Derthona smell and taste like?
Signature aromas of Timorasso Derthona include lemon peel, pear, white flowers and lemon. Structural profile: Medium(+) body, High acidity, Medium alcohol.

Where is Timorasso Derthona grown?
Classic regions for Timorasso Derthona include Piedmont, Colli Tortonesi and Derthona.
